Land Bounded By Stanley Street To The North And North West, Haydock Street, Bridge Street And Queen Street To The East, Market Street To The West, Queen Street And Railway Street To The South Earlestown St Helens

Granted St. Helens P/2024/0114/RES Reserved Matters

Permission granted.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ses.

Proposal

Reserved Matters Application following outline consent P/2022/0213/HYBR seeking approval for Access, Appearance, Landscaping, Layout and Scale for the development of a proposed market canopy, with associated landscaping, parking, servicing and public realm works at Market Square. Along with details required by conditions to be submitted with reserved matters no. 9, 10, 11, 13, 15, 16, 17, 18, and satisfy other relevant conditions.

What a grant of permission means

The process from here

Permission has been granted, usually subject to conditions listed on the decision notice, some of which must be discharged before work starts. The decision notice on the council portal sets out exactly what was approved.

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ses. Neighbours cannot appeal a grant; challenging one means judicial review of how the decision was made, within tight time limits.

About reserved matters applications

How this application type works

A reserved matters application fills in the detail held back from an earlier outline permission, typically appearance, landscaping, layout, scale or access. The council judges it against the outline permission already granted, not the principle of development, which is settled. It must normally be submitted within three years of the outline decision.
